GPRC names new head coach for soccer teams

Grande Prairie Regional Colleg has announced their new head coach for their men’s and women’s soccer teams. Chris Morgan will take on the position with ten years of experience under his belt.

Morgan coached for 8 years in Belfast in Northern Ireland with the Carryduff Colts Soccer Club. For the last two years, he has been a Learning Facilitator with the Alberta Soccer Association as well as Technical Director for Fort St. John Soccer Club.

The new head coach says he is looking forward to the season getting underway and representing Northern Ireland in Alberta.

The Women’s teams first home game will be against Concordia Thunder at 2:00 pm at Pomeroy Field on September 17th, 2016. The Men’s team will play at the same field at 4:00 pm.
